Is Post Honey Bunches of Oats Honey Roasted, Crunchy Breakfast Cereal, 12 oz Box Dairy Free?

Yes! We believe this product is dairy free as there are no dairy ingredients listed on the label.

Description

Sweet honey-roasted flavor and a mix of crunchy clusters and delicate flakes produce a crisp mouthfeel. Commonly eaten with milk, enjoyed as an on-the-go snack, or sprinkled over yogurt and desserts. Reviews cite satisfying crunch and sweetness; some mention occasional variation in cluster size, sweetness, and packaging consistency issues reported.

Ingredients

Corn, Whole Grain Wheat, Sugar, Whole Grain Rolled Oats, Rice, Canola And/Or Soybean Oil, Wheat Flour, Malted Barley Flour, Corn Syrup, Salt, Molasses Honey, Caramel Color, Barley Malt Extract, Natural And Artificial Flavor, Annatto Extract (Color), Bht Added To Preserve Freshness. Vitamins And Minerals: Reduced Iron, Niacinamide (Vitamin B3), Vitamin A Palmitate, Pyridoxine Hydrochloride (Vitamin B6), Zinc Oxide, Thiamin Mononitrate (Vitamin B1), Riboflavin (Vitamin B2), Folic Acid, Vitamin B3, Vitamin B12.

What is a Dairy Free diet?

A dairy-free diet eliminates all foods made from or containing milk and milk-derived ingredients, such as butter, cheese, yogurt, and cream. It's essential for people with lactose intolerance, milk allergies, or those who prefer plant-based alternatives. Common dairy substitutes include almond, soy, oat, and coconut-based milks and cheeses. While dairy is a major source of calcium and vitamin D, these nutrients can be replaced through fortified foods or supplements. Many people find going dairy-free helps reduce digestive issues, acne, or inflammation, but balance and proper nutrient intake remain key for long-term health.
